This number helps explain why many Americans are down on the economy

American workers’ share of the economic pie has fallen to its lowest level since at least 1947, when the federal government began tracking the data, according to an analysis by Federal Reserve economists.  The measure, known as “labor share of income,” tracks how much of the nation’s economic output flows to workers in the form … Read more

Your blood pressure reading contains a hidden number — and here’s why it matters

You’re likely familiar with getting your blood pressure taken, the cuff squeezing your arm before generating two numbers. Yet this vital sign contains a third, lesser-known number that matters for brain and heart health: pulse pressure. WHO scales back number of suspected Ebola cases in Congo, but frontline medics say major challenges remain

The United Nations’ World Health Organization significantly scaled back on Tuesday the number of suspected Ebola cases in central Africa, lowering it to 116 from more than 900, with 330 total cases confirmed.
